What is energy produced by splitting the nuclei of certain elements?

Nuclear energy is produced by splitting the nuclei of certain elements in a process called nuclear fission. This process releases a large amount of energy in the form of heat, which can be used to generate electricity in nuclear power plants. Examples of elements that can undergo nuclear fission include uranium and plutonium.

How does nuclear energy can be produced?

Nuclear energy is produced through a process called nuclear fission, where the nucleus of an atom is split into smaller parts. This process releases a significant amount of energy in the form of heat, which is then used to generate electricity. The most common fuel used for nuclear energy production is uranium.


Is nuclear energy produced extracted or refined?

Nuclear energy is produced through the process of nuclear fission, which involves splitting atoms to release energy. This process does not involve extraction or refinement like fossil fuels, but rather relies on the controlled chain reaction within a nuclear reactor to generate heat and then electricity.

What is nuclear fission energy?

Nuclear Fission Energy is energy that is produced using fissionable elements. The most common is Uranium. Fission energy involves the fission heating water and turning a turbine, much like coal.


Is nuclear energy mined?

No, nuclear energy is not mined. Nuclear energy is produced by splitting atoms in a process called nuclear fission, which releases energy. The fuel used in nuclear reactors, such as uranium or plutonium, is mined from the earth.

What process does nuclear energy go through?

If you're referring to nuclear energy in power generating plants, it is nuclear fission. If you're referring to the nuclear energy in our Sun, it is nuclear fusion.


What is the name of the process in which the nuclear fuels release energy?

The process where nuclear fuels release energy is called nuclear fission. It involves splitting the nucleus of an atom into two or more smaller nuclei, releasing a large amount of energy in the process.
